CHRISSY TEIGEN'S JALAPEñO-CHEDDAR CORN PUDDING RECIPE BY TASTY



Chrissy Teigen's Jalapeño-Cheddar Corn Pudding Recipe by Tasty image

Here's what you need: jalapeño, corn, butter, heavy cream, cornstarch, shredded cheddar cheese, cream-style corn, eggs, kosher salt

Provided by Katie Aubin

Categories     Sides

Time 50m

Yield 10 servings

Number Of Ingredients 9

¼ cup jalapeño, 2 large or 4 small
2 large ears corn, or 1 can of corn kernels, drained
4 tablespoons butter, melted, plus more for the pan
¾ cup heavy cream
2 tablespoons cornstarch
2 cups shredded cheddar cheese
15 oz cream-style corn, 2 cans
6 eggs
kosher salt

Steps:

  • Using food safe gloves, dice the jalapeños, and cut the kernels off of the ears of corn.
  • Preheat the oven to 350°F (180 °C). Grease a 9x13-inch (23x33-cm) baking pan with butter.
  • In a large bowl, whisk the cornstarch into the heavy cream until smooth. Add 1½ cups (150 g) of cheddar, the creamed corn, fresh corn, jalapeños, melted butter, eggs, and salt and stir well. Taste and add more salt if necessary.
  • Pour the pudding into the baking pan and top with the remaining ½ cup cheddar.
  • Bake until set, 45-50 minutes. Fire up the broiler and broil until the top is browned, 1-2 minutes.
  • Enjoy!

SAGAPONACK CORN PUDDING



Sagaponack Corn Pudding image

Provided by Ina Garten

Categories     side-dish

Time 1h5m

Yield 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 13

1/4 pound (1 stick) unsalted butter
5 cups fresh yellow corn kernels cut off the cob (6 to 8 ears)
1 cup chopped yellow onion (1 onion)
4 extra-large eggs
1 cup milk
1 cup half-and-half
1/2 cup yellow cornmeal
1 cup ricotta cheese
3 tablespoons chopped fresh basil leaves
1 tablespoon sugar
1 tablespoon kosher salt
3/4 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
3/4 cup (6 ounces) grated extra-sharp cheddar, plus extra to sprinkle on top

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 375 degrees F. Grease the inside of an 8 to 10-cup baking dish.
  • Melt the butter in a very large saute pan and saute the corn and onion over medium-high heat for 4 minutes. Cool slightly.
  • Whisk together the eggs, milk, and half-and-half in a large bowl. Slowly whisk in the cornmeal and then the ricotta. Add the basil, sugar, salt, and pepper. Add the cooked corn mixture and grated cheddar, and then pour into the baking dish. Sprinkle the top with more grated cheddar.
  • Place the dish in a larger pan and fill the pan 1/2 way up the sides of the dish with hot tap water. Bake the pudding for 40 to 45 minutes until the top begins to brown and a knife inserted in the center comes out clean. Serve warm.

JALAPENO CORN PUDDING



Jalapeno Corn Pudding image

This is a wonderful combination of the Old West and the Deep South- a side dish with some kick! Originally from the R.S.V.P. section of a December 1989 issue of Bon Apetit. It's a recipe requested from the Old Pineville Depot Restaurant in Charlotte, North Carolina.

Provided by Leslie in Texas

Categories     Corn

Time 1h20m

Yield 9-12 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 1/2 cups creamed corn
1 cup yellow cornmeal
1 cup butter, melted (2 sticks)
3/4 cup buttermilk
2 medium onions, chopped
2 eggs, beaten
1/2 teaspoon baking soda
1 1/2-2 cups sharp cheddar cheese, grated
3 jalapeno peppers, seeded, deveined and diced

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ees.
  • Grease a 9-inch square baking pan.
  • Combine first seven ingredients in a large bowl and mix well.
  • Turn half of batter into pan: cover evenly with half of cheese, then peppers, then remaining cheese.
  • Top with remaining batter.
  • Bake 60 minutes.
  • Let cool 15 minutes, cut into squares and serve.

BAKED CORN PUDDING



Baked Corn Pudding image

Provided by Sunny Anderson

Categories     side-dish

Time 1h50m

Yield 6 to 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 9

3 tablespoons butter, plus extra for casserole
1/2 large onion, chopped
1 jalapeno, chopped
3 tablespoons all-purpose flour
2 cups milk
1 cup shredded Cheddar
2 eggs, beaten
1 (10-ounce) bag frozen corn
Salt and freshly ground black pepper 1/4 cup bread crumbs 1/4 cup grated Parmesan

Steps:

  • Special equipment: 8 by 8-inch casserole
  • Preheat oven to 325 degrees F.
  • In a large saucepan on medium heat, melt butter and saute onions and jalapenos until tender, about 5 minutes. Add flour and stir to coat evenly, being sure to not burn the onions. Cook flour until golden brown, about 3 minutes. Whisk in milk and cheese and stir until melted, then remove from heat. Add the eggs to a small bowl, and stir in 1/4 cup of hot mixture to temper the eggs. Stir add the egg mixture into the pan, along with corn, and season with salt and pepper, to taste. Pour into a buttered 8 by 8-inch casserole dish. In a small bowl, mix together bread crumbs and Parmesan cheese. Sprinkle evenly over top of casserole, place in the oven and bake until custard sets and the top is golden brown, about 45 minutes.

JALAPENO CORN PUDDING



JALAPENO CORN PUDDING image

Categories     Side     Bake     Stuffing/Dressing     Hominy/Cornmeal/Masa

Yield 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 14

2 T butter
1 cup chopped onion
1 cup fresh corn kernels cut from 1 large ear of corn
1/3 cup finel chopped seeded jalapeno chiles
3 garlic cloves, chopped
1 cup corn meal
1 1/2 cups whole milk
1/2 cup heavy whipping cream
1 cup chopped roasted red bell peppers, from jar, drained
1/2 cup chopped green onions
1/2 cup chopped fresh cilantro
1/2 tsp freshly ground black pepper
3 large eggs
1 cup coarsely grated Manchego cheese or sharp cheddar cheese

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Butter 2 quart shallow baking dish. Melt 2 tablespoons butter in large skillet over medium-high heat. Add onion, corn, jalapeno, and garlic saute until soft, about 4 minutes, stir in cornmeal. Add milk and cream; stir over medium high heat until thick batter forms. Sitr in red onions, cilantro, 1 tsp salt and pepper; cool 15 minutes. Stir in egg yolks. Using mixer with clean, dry beaters, beat egg whites in medium bowl until soft peaks form. Fold whites into batter. Transfer to dish. Sprinkle with cheese. Bake pudding until top is golden and center is just set, about 35 minutes. Serve immediately.

CORN PUDDING WITH JALAPENO



Corn Pudding With Jalapeno image

If you want no spice at all omit the jalapeno pepper. You can double the recipe and make it in a 13 x 9-inch baking pan. You can make this into a sweet corn pudding by increasing the sugar to 6-7 tablespoons and omitting the Parmesan and shredded cheese. This recipe will lend itself well to really anything you want to add in.

Provided by Kittencalrecipezazz

Categories     Cheese

Time 55m

Yield 4-6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 13

4 1/2 cups frozen corn kernels (can use a bit less)
4 large eggs
1 cup whipping cream
1/2 cup whole milk
3 tablespoons sugar (or to taste)
1/4 cup butter, room temperature
2 tablespoons flour
2 teaspoons baking powder
1 1/2 teaspoons seasoning salt (or use white salt)
black pepper or cayenne
3 tablespoons grated parmesan cheese (or to taste)
1 jalapeno pepper, seeded and finely chopped (or to taste)
2 cups grated cheddar cheese (or to taste)

Steps:

  • Set oven to 350 degrees.
  • Butter a 8 x 8-inch glass baking dish.
  • In a food processor blend the first 10 ingredients (up to the Parmesan cheese) until smooth.
  • Pour the batter into a bowl and mix in jalapeno and Parmesan cheese; mix to combine and season with more salt and pepper if desired.
  • Pour into buttered baking dish.
  • Bake for about 35 minutes, remove and sprinkle grated cheddar cheese on top.
  • Return to the oven and bake for 10 minutes longer, or until the center is set.
  • Cool for 10 minutes before serving.
